whats up going to start my turbo miata build
 
whats up guys,
In the works is my 1.6 turbo DD build. Basically I use to be an rx7 guy (well still kinda am) but bought a miata about 2 years ago as a dd. Now I love the car :). any ways ive built or help build several turbo cars (my huge street port fc rx7 with a borg warner s300 on it. several rb series 240s. and a few other cars).

as for the miata i love it. its a grate daily but its slow :( so to put some pep in its step im going to turbo it. My goal for it is 150-175hp. Im really not looking for that much lol just enough to have fun around the mountain roads where i live.

I plan on doing this this summer. I'm going mega squirt because its cheep and easy to tune. prob going to get an ebay cast mani and build the rest of the exhaust work. Im still going to run a cat and a hopefully quite exhaust (remember DD).

Im about to do a 1.8 brake up grade. Dont worry im not a typical noob that dosnt search :loser: . (caliper brackets, rotors and pads from a 1.8)
